关于comsol的那些保姆级技巧
作者:互联网
一、 几何建模
COMSOL Multiphysics 提供丰富的工具,供用户在图形化界面中构建自己的几何模型,例如 1D 中
通过点、线,2D 中可以通过点、线、矩形、圆/椭圆、贝塞尔曲线等,3D 中通过球/椭球、立方体、
台、点、线等构建几何结构,另外,通过镜像、复制、移动、比例缩放等工具对几何对象进行高级操
作,还可以通过布尔运算方式进行几何结构之间的切割、粘合等操作。
COMSOL Multiphysics 以 Parasolid 格式为 CAD 内核,可以完美地导入当前大部分专业 CAD 软件制
作的几何结构。
COMSOL Multiphysics 支持两种几何体,缺省的组合几何体和装配体,前者很方便地处理内部边界
条件问题,后者很方便处理复杂结构的建模、网格、以及求解等问题。
除了这些绘图工具,COMSOL Multiphysics 还可以在脚本环境中构建几何对象,然后直接从脚本环
境导入几何体,实现利用脚本建模。
组合体和装配体
COMSOL Multiphysics 中有两种几何体,组合几何体(缺省)和装配体。所谓的组合几何
体指重叠的几何对象自动分解为多个求解域(与几何无关),其内部界面上,几何结构、网
格以及物理量等自动相互“粘合”。装配体则表示重叠的几何对象之间没有构成关系,因此
从本质上而言,不存在内部界面。
这两种几何体各有优缺点,组合几何体是 COMSOL Multiphysics 的缺省设定,优点在于:
在材料非连续处,物理量自动连续
在材料界面处,自动得到高精度解
在材料界面处,自动确认网格单元和节点
其缺点在于:
网格越细,内存开销越大
对大的 CAD 模型网格剖分比较困难
反过来,装配体的优点则在于:
在材料界面处可有意定义物理量不连续,例如接触阻抗
对大的 CAD 模型网格剖分比较容易
网格越粗,计算越快(但精度越低)
装配体的缺点:
需要更多的手工操作
为了保证足够的高精度,需要注意边界上的网格密度
通常,COMSOL Multiphysics 缺省使用组合几何体,因为这种情况下内部边界可以采用缺
省的连续边界。
有时候,几何结构比较复杂,采用组合几何体时容易出现内部几何结构错误,或几何结
构的各个部分有较大的差异(如薄壳与厚板等),或采用简化的方法模拟膜、壳等结构时需
要设定该简化边界为阻抗型边界条件,或不同的求解域需要剖分成不同的网格,或采用 ALE
框架模拟旋转运动等的情况下,可采用装配体。
用户可以通过选择几何结点中的形成组合体节点设定区的定型方法来切换到正确的几何
解析方法:形成组合体和形成装配体。
值得注意的是,当在不同表现形式间切换时,COMSOL Multiphysics 将自动调整求解域、
边界等的编号,从而影响到相关的设定,用户需要检查所有的设定是否条例设计条件。
隐藏部分几何
复杂的几何,常常存在于内部结构,我们可以采用增加透明度的方法来使得内部可视化。另一种
常用的方法则是将外层几何隐藏起来,直观地看到内部结构,并进行建模。
下图所示为图形工作窗口区中的工具条的截图,从左向右的前四个按钮分别代表:隐藏选定,显
示选定,重置隐藏,察看未隐藏/只察看隐藏/察看所有。通过对这四个操作的合理选择,我们就可以
观察所需的结构。
工作面
在很多情况下,我们经常进行 3D 结构的多物理场耦合分析,当我们需要对一些几何结构进行内
部开孔/槽,或者增加几何附件等操作时,可以采用工作面来快速建模。
例如在案例库中基本模块声学分支中的案例:COMSOL Multiphysics>Acoustics>eigenmodes of room
的几何建模过程,首先绘制一个立方体表征房间,然后基于地板建立工作面,在该工作面中绘制出沙
发底座、茶几底座和电视柜等的底座,通过拉伸得到相应的几何实体。接下来以沙发座的顶面为工作
面,依托该工作面绘制出扶手的轮廓,向斜后方拉伸(拉伸距离为 0.4m,在 x 方向位移为-0.1m),
如下图所示。
修整导入的几何结构
有时候,由于不同 CAD 软件之间的数据格式、取值误差等的差异,会出现导入的几何
结构存在缺陷。COMSOL Multiphysics 提供修复工具,供用户修复缺陷,或削除较小结构等。
用户可以在几何节点下右键添加相关的工具:CAD 削除、CAD 修复。下面对这些工具做一些
形象的说明,具体操作请参考用户手册。
处理短边
导入的结构中,存在很短的边,该边不影响几何结构,但是将会影响网格剖分、边界设
定等,可能会影响到求解的收敛性。COMSOL Multiphysics 的修复短边工具将把短边删除,
并将相连的边延长连接到角上。
处理重合边
导入的结构中,可能会出现有重合的边,该边一般不影响几何结构,很难发现,但是会
影响边界设定和求解域的完整性,最终可能会得到错误的结果或不收敛。COMSOL
Multiphysics 的修复重合边工具将把其中一条重合边删除。
处理尖角
导入的结构可能出现如下图中的两种尖角,将会在求解域中出现类似应力集中的现象,
从而影响收敛性和解的正确性。COMSOL Multiphysics 的修复工具将去掉尖角的一条边,将
另一条边的顶角与最近的顶角相连
处理自相交
导入的结构出现了交叉的现象,从而影响实体的构成,可能无法进行物理量的设定。
COMSOL Multiphysics 的修复工具将把交叉的线缩短,顶点相交,或把交叉成环的小实体删
除,得到一个正常的角。
标签:comsol,Multiphysics,网格,技巧,保姆,几何,结构,几何体,COMSOL 来源: https://blog.csdn.net/hdpai2018/article/details/115397627